mysql設置遠程登陸後鏈接不上

mysql設置遠程登陸後鏈接不上mysql

參考:http://www.jb51.net/article/33813.htmsql

http://www.jb51.net/article/58096.htmvim

默認狀況下,MySQL只容許本地登陸,若是要開啓遠程鏈接,則須要修改/etc/my.cnf文件

sudo vim /etc/mysql/my.cnf
註釋這一行:bind-address=127.0.0.1spa

保存退出。
mysql -u root -p.net

爲須要遠程登陸的用戶賦予權限:rest

代碼以下:
mysql>use mysql;
mysql> delete from user where user='';(刪除匿名用戶)
mysql> G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Y "123" with grant option;(123爲密碼)
mysql> flush privileges;

退出mysql(exit)code

而後重啓mysql服務(sudo service mysql restart)htm

遠程登陸命令:
mysql -h 125.216.231.188 -u root -p(-h後跟的是要登陸主機的ip地址)ip

相關文章
相關標籤/搜索